net/smc: Ensure the active closing peer first closes clcsock

[ Upstream commit 606a63c9 ]

The side that actively closed socket, it's clcsock doesn't enter
TIME_WAIT state, but the passive side does it. It should show the same
behavior as TCP sockets.

Consider this, when client actively closes the socket, the clcsock in
server enters TIME_WAIT state, which means the address is occupied and
won't be reused before TIME_WAIT dismissing. If we restarted server, the
service would be unavailable for a long time.

To solve this issue, shutdown the clcsock in [A], perform the TCP active
close progress first, before the passive closed side closing it. So that
the actively closed side enters TIME_WAIT, not the passive one.

Client                                            |  Server
close() // client actively close                  |
  smc_release()                                   |
      smc_close_active() // PEERCLOSEWAIT1        |
          smc_close_final() // abort or closed = 1|
              smc_cdc_get_slot_and_msg_send()     |
          [A]                                     |
                                                  |smc_cdc_msg_recv_action() // ACTIVE
                                                  |  queue_work(smc_close_wq, &conn->close_work)
                                                  |    smc_close_passive_work() // PROCESSABORT or APPCLOSEWAIT1
                                                  |      smc_close_passive_abort_received() // only in abort
                                                  |
                                                  |close() // server recv zero, close
                                                  |  smc_release() // PROCESSABORT or APPCLOSEWAIT1
                                                  |    smc_close_active()
                                                  |      smc_close_abort() or smc_close_final() // CLOSED
                                                  |        smc_cdc_get_slot_and_msg_send() // abort or closed = 1
smc_cdc_msg_recv_action()                         |    smc_clcsock_release()
  queue_work(smc_close_wq, &conn->close_work)     |      sock_release(tcp) // actively close clc, enter TIME_WAIT
    smc_close_passive_work() // PEERCLOSEWAIT1    |    smc_conn_free()
      smc_close_passive_abort_received() // CLOSED|
      smc_conn_free()                             |
      smc_clcsock_release()                       |
        sock_release(tcp) // passive close clc    |
